PJSIP是一个开放源代码SIP协议栈。它支持多种SIP扩展功能,目前可说算是最流行sip协议栈之一了。下面列出其重要几种优点:1)代码层次非常清晰,从低级到高级都提供了很方便接口供开发;2)提供相当多测试用例和一个基于pjsip开发命令行UA程序供开发人员参考; 3).高度可移殖性 只需简单编译一次,它能够在多种平台上运行(所有Windows 系统列, Windows Mob
# 实现“海康ISUP SDK java开发”教程 ## 整体流程 下面是实现“海康ISUP SDK java开发整体流程: | 步骤 | 描述 | | --- | --- | | 1 | 下载并配置ISUP SDK | | 2 | 创建Java项目 | | 3 | 导入ISUP SDK | | 4 | 编写代码调用ISUP SDK 接口 | ## 具体步骤及代码示例 ### 步骤1
原创 2024-03-03 05:33:44
1466阅读
1评论
目录一、数据类型扩展二、变量作用域三、常量四、运算符五、用户交互Scanner六、循环结构七、Java流程控制break、continue八、方法重载九、可变参数 十、递归递归结构包括两部分:十一、面向对象(OOP)十二、static关键字十三、抽象类十四、接口Interface十五、内部类十六、Error和Exception一、数据类型扩展A、整数扩展:进制  二进制以0b开
转载 2024-09-18 20:32:27
55阅读
# Java对接海康ISUP协议探讨 ## 一、ISUP协议概述 ISUP(ISDN User Part)协议是为了支持公共交换电话网(PSTN)中信令而设计。海康威视公司在其产品中实现了对ISUP协议支持,尤其是在视频监控和智能交通等领域。通过正确地实现ISUP协议开发人员可以实现与海康设备无缝对接。 ### 二、Java中对接ISUP协议思路 在Java中对接ISUP协议
原创 2024-09-04 04:06:01
927阅读
协议栈是指网络中各层协议总和,其形象反映了一个网络中文件传输过程:由上层协议到底层协议,再由底层协议到上层协议。使用最广泛是英特网协议栈,由上到下协议分别是:应用层(HTTP,TELNET,DNS,EMAIL等),运输层(TCP,UDP),网络层(IP),链路层(WI-FI,以太网,令牌环,FDDI等),物理层。   协议栈 Protocol
# 海康ISUP协议对接Java ## 1. 简介 海康ISUP协议是海康威视公司提供一种用于视频监控系统通讯协议。它基于Java语言,为开发者提供了一种方便快捷方式来与海康威视设备进行通讯。 在本文中,我们将学习如何使用Java编写代码来对接海康ISUP协议,并提供一些代码示例来帮助理解。 ## 2. 准备工作 在开始编写代码之前,我们需要先准备一些必要工作: - 下载并安
原创 2024-02-07 08:25:23
2170阅读
CGI是什么CGI是common gateway interface缩写,大家都译作通用网关接口,但很不幸,我们无法见名知意。 我们知道,web服务器所处理内容都是静态,要想处理动态内容,需要依赖于web应用程序,如php、jsp、python、perl等。但是web server如何将动态请求传递给这些应用程序?它所依赖就是cgi协议。没错,是协议,也就是web server和web
转载 2024-08-27 22:39:39
127阅读
在现代化微服务架构中,Spring Boot以其简洁、灵活特性被广泛应用于开发微服务应用。而ISUP(ISDN User Part)协议则是在网络领域中,尤其是声频交换中,作为信号传递一种重要协议。本文将详细阐述如何解决与Spring Boot ISUP协议相关问题,结合不同内容结构,包括环境配置、编译过程、参数调优、定制开发、调试技巧和生态集成等方面。 ### 环境配置 在配置Sp
原创 6月前
31阅读
好久没写博客了,最近做一个项目,需要直接对接海康摄像头,调用海康SDK。这个项目原来是C/S模式单机版,改版后是B/S模式,调用SDK就比较麻烦了。首先,还看SDK分了好几个版本,至少常用服务器来说有windows或者linux(centos),甚至可能是麒麟。那么问题来了,从官网提供例子来看,调用库在不同操作系统上不一样,不能一套代码发布在2个平台上。另外就是很多时候大家开发环境是wi
转载 2024-01-27 16:14:25
1663阅读
1. 简介上一篇文章中我们研究了Loock Touch门锁配套app中BleKey获取流程,整个密钥分发和设备认证流程都比较规范。接下来,我们将重点分析门锁固件对BLE通信内容处理流程,开始分析之前,我们需要先获取门锁固件。之前文章我们已经介绍了两种获取固件方法:在果加门锁分析文章中,我们抓取了门锁向服务器请求固件更新时数据包;在分析海康萤石网关时,我们直接读取了电路板上Flash
转载 2024-10-11 11:22:16
254阅读
1.ArrayList类    基本格式:          例:     对元素基本操作:               public boolean add(E e) :将指定
门禁话机通常使用协议主要有以下几种:SIP协议:SIP(Session Initiation Protocol)会话初始化协议,是一种基于文本协议,用于建立、修改和终止实时会话,例如语音电话、视频电话和即时消息等。门禁话机使用SIP协议可以与其他SIP设备进行通信,例如VoIP电话和SIP服务器等。MQTT协议:MQTT(Message Queuing Telemetry Transport)
Java配置SAP——Java调用SAP系统RFC接口前言名词说明代码结构各个文件作用连接方式sapjco3.jar包导入源码示例CallRfc.javaJCOProviderRfcManagerpom文件报错信息解决错误描述错误分析组/服务器选择连接方式配置 前言名词说明RFC:(Remote Function Call,远程功能调用)。 SAP系统:是ERP解决方案先驱,也是全世界排
EtherNet IP以太网IO接口工业读写器|读卡器CK-FR12-E01是一款基于射频识别技术高频RFID标签读卡器,读卡器工作频率为13.56MHZ,支持对I-CODE 2、I-CODE SLI等符合ISO15693国际标准协议格式标签读取。读卡器同时支持标准工业通讯协议EtherNet IP,方便用户通集成到PLC等控制系统中。读卡器内部集成了射频部分通信协议,用户只需通过以太网接口接
着重介绍了IWU上实现SIP和ISUP互通原则和机制,为实现PSTN向软
转载 2023-01-27 22:47:04
513阅读
微信开发sdk协议,出自冬天不穿秋裤,天冷也要风度程序猿之手,必属精品!一、网络通讯协议如上图,采用 datalength+databytes 自定义长度协议,其中:datalength:紧跟其后databytes数据长度(不包含自身长度),占4字节databytes:protobuf 3.0协议数据序列化后数据内容,长度不限二、网络应答模型1、业务消息服务端客户端间...
1、是什么? 2010年迁移到了google code,并且改名为MyBatis。ibatis1、ibatis2、到了版本3就改名为mybatis。 iBATIS是一个持久层框架,它能够自动在 Java, .NET, 和Ruby on Rails中与SQL数据库和对象之间映射。映射是从应用程序逻辑封装在XML配置文件中SQL语句脱钩。 iBATIS是一个轻量级框架和持久性API适合持久
近期有位开发者为了用我们国标GB28181流媒体服务器进行测试,在自己现场环境安装了海康有线摄像头,通过4g转wifi来连接,上传视频到平台之后,打开视频最长需要10分钟左右才能显示,大多数时候要3~4分钟才能出来,为此这位开发者找到我们技术支持,寻求帮助。此种情况就是视频直播中最常见延迟情况,我们技术支持是建议这位开发者先降低码率和分辨率进行测试,可以在下图地址中调试分辨率和码率:
转载 2023-10-30 21:00:09
102阅读
首先,什么是SDK呢?   Software Develop Kit简称,顾名思义就是软件开发包。软件开发商实现底层模块,并对其进行类库封装,配置成高级别的开发环境,为程序员上层程序开发提供支持。譬如Google APP SDKSDK用于帮助开发人员提高工作效率。各种不同类型软件开发,都可以有自己SDK。Windows有Windows SDK,DirectX 有 Direct
转载 2024-06-20 06:51:26
45阅读
HTTP服务器端口:默认端口号为80/tcp(木马Executor开放此端口) 服务:HTTP服务器 说明:TCP访问端口。用于网页浏览。HTTPS(securely transferring web pages)服务器端口:默认端口号为443/tcp 443/udp 服务:HTTPS(securely transferring web pages) 说明:HTTP协议代理服务器常用端口号端口:8
  • 1
  • 2
  • 3
  • 4
  • 5